A US conservation foundation funds on-the-ground rhino conservation programs across Africa and Asia, including anti-poaching operations, habitat protection, captive breeding, environmental education, and demand reduction initiatives. Eligible applicants are organizations working directly on rhino conservation and related wildlife protection in target geographies.
About this grant
On-the-ground programs in Africa and Asia supporting anti-poaching, habitat conservation, captive breeding, environmental education, and demand reduction for all five rhino species. Over $20 million invested over the last decade.
